Chapter 7 Rack2-Viewer Window Operations
7.20 Searching for a Page
This section describes how to search for a page by specifying a string contained
in the page.
Types of strings that can be searched for are as follows:
•
Contents
•
Divider sheet
•
Sticky note
•
Stamp
•
Hyperlink text
•
Key text blocks created by OCR or typed manually to a binder
•
Strings in comments that are set for the photos or documents
To search for a page, the types of strings to search for, which are listed above,
should first be set for each page. Only pages with a search string set in advance
can be searched for.
To set key text blocks, create key text blocks by OCR, or type in the [Key Text
Block] dialog box.
By specifying the search condition (string), pages including the string will be
searched. When pages are displayed after a search, the target string can be
highlighted. This function makes it easy to find a target string in the Rack2-
Viewer window. For more details on search result highlights, refer to
"Highlighting search results" (Page 212).
